Using a rotating magnetic guiding field for the 3He-129Xe-Comagnetometer

High Energy Physics - Phenomenology 2017-08-23 v1 Atomic Physics

Abstract

Our search for non-magnetic spin-dependent interactions is based on the measurement of free precession of nuclear spin polarized 3He and 129Xe atoms in a homogeneous magnetic guiding field of about 400 nT. We report on our approach to perform an adiabatic rotation of the guiding field that allows us to modulate possible non-magnetic spin-dependent interactions and to find an optimization procedure for long transverse relaxation times T2* both for Helium and Xenon.
